Dependability certification of services: a model-based approach

被引:0
|
作者
Claudio A. Ardagna
Ravi Jhawar
Vincenzo Piuri
机构
[1] Università degli Studi di Milano,Dipartimento di Informatica
来源
Computing | 2015年 / 97卷
关键词
BPEL; Dependability certification; Markov chains ; Web services; 68M14 Distributed systems; 68M15 Reliability; testing and fault tolerance;
D O I
暂无
中图分类号
学科分类号
摘要
The advances and success of the Service-Oriented Architecture (SOA) paradigm have produced a revolution in ICT, particularly, in the way in which software applications are implemented and distributed. Today, applications are increasingly provisioned and consumed as web services over the Internet, and business processes are implemented by dynamically composing loosely coupled applications provided by different suppliers. In this highly dynamic context, clients (e.g., business owners or users selecting a service) are concerned about the dependability of their services and business processes. In this paper, we define a certification scheme that allows to verify the dependability properties of services and business processes. Our certification scheme relies on discrete-time Markov chains and awards machine-readable dependability certificates to services, whose validity is continuously verified using run-time monitoring. Our solution can be integrated within existing SOAs, to extend the discovery and selection process with dependability requirements and certificates, and to support a dependability-aware service composition.
引用
收藏
页码:51 / 78
页数:27
相关论文
共 50 条
  • [31] Model-Based Approach to Analysis of Human Behavior with Applications to Nursing and Caregiving Services
    Kobayashi, Koichi
    Hiraishi, Kunihiko
    Choe, Sunseong
    Uchihira, Naoshi
    [J]. 2017 IEEE 6TH GLOBAL CONFERENCE ON CONSUMER ELECTRONICS (GCCE), 2017,
  • [32] Dependability Assessment of SOA-Based CPS With Contracts and Model-Based Fault Injection
    Dal Lago, Loris
    Ferrante, Orlando
    Passerone, Roberto
    Ferrari, Alberto
    [J]. IEEE TRANSACTIONS ON INDUSTRIAL INFORMATICS, 2018, 14 (01) : 360 - 369
  • [33] Electricity Services Based Dependability Model of Power Grid Communication Networking
    Wang, Jiye
    Meng, Kun
    Cao, Junwei
    Chen, Zhen
    Gao, Lingchao
    Lin, Chuang
    [J]. TSINGHUA SCIENCE AND TECHNOLOGY, 2014, 19 (02) : 121 - 132
  • [34] Electricity Services Based Dependability Model of Power Grid Communication Networking
    Jiye Wang
    Kun Meng
    Junwei Cao
    Zhen Chen
    Lingchao Gao
    Chuang Lin
    [J]. Tsinghua Science and Technology, 2014, 19 (02) : 121 - 132
  • [35] Model-Based Software Engineering and Certification: Some Open Issues
    Russo, Stefano
    Scippacercola, Fabio
    [J]. 2016 IEEE 27TH INTERNATIONAL SYMPOSIUM ON SOFTWARE RELIABILITY ENGINEERING WORKSHOPS (ISSREW), 2016, : 237 - 240
  • [36] Towards Making Dependability Visual - Combining Model-Based Design and Virtual Realities
    Guedemann, Matthias
    Lipaczewski, Michael
    Ortmeier, Frank
    Schumann, Marco
    Eschbach, Robert
    [J]. 2011 IEEE 17TH PACIFIC RIM INTERNATIONAL SYMPOSIUM ON DEPENDABLE COMPUTING (PRDC), 2011, : 274 - +
  • [37] Model-Based Dependability Assessment of Phased-Mission Unmanned Aerial Vehicles
    Steurer, Mikael
    Morozov, Andrey
    Janschek, Klaus
    Neitzke, Klaus-Peter
    [J]. IFAC PAPERSONLINE, 2020, 53 (02): : 8915 - 8922
  • [38] Certification of system architecture dependability
    Levendel, I
    [J]. PARALLEL AND DISTRIBUTED PROCESSING, PROCEEDINGS, 2000, 1800 : 1202 - 1203
  • [39] Testing Web Services with Model-Based Mutation
    Siavashi, Faezeh
    Iqbal, Junaid
    Truscan, Dragos
    Vain, Juri
    [J]. SOFTWARE TECHNOLOGIES, 2017, 743 : 45 - 67
  • [40] Model-based Integration Testing of Enterprise Services
    Wieczorek, Sebastian
    Stefanescu, Alin
    Schieferdecker, Ina
    [J]. 2009 TESTING: ACADEMIC AND INDUSTRIAL CONFERENCE-PRACTICE AND RESEARCH TECHNIQUES, TAIC PART 2009, 2009, : 56 - +